Having seen Princes Charles and his two sons last Thursday at the Invictus Games, it reminded me of the last time I saw Princes William and Harry. It was about 26 years ago and my son had just been born in the same hospital as Fergie had just given birth to her first daughter. My son was born two days after Princess Beatrice and from my bedroom window, I could see the people who came to visit her, although it was often hard to see who they were from the top of their heads! Photographers were camped outside the hospital snapping all Fergie’s visitors and the clicking of their camera shutters gave me lots of warning that a royal visitor had arrived.

Princess Diana came with her two sons and I managed to photograph her from above. Sadly, that was the only time I ever saw her.

The following day I saw Fergie and Beatrice leave the hospital, although I didn’t manage to get a photograph. She ran across the road to say hello to the photographers, before taking Beatrice home.

It was quite exciting being in the same hospital as royalty but nowhere near as exciting as having just given birth to my son!
